What Is the Yeezy Gap Sweatshirt Made Of?
The fabric of the Yeezy Gap Sweatshirt is essentially a blend of cotton, with some variations adding polyester for stretch and strength. Polyester adds durability, reducing the fabric’s propensity to shrink and wrinkle, while cotton is renowned for its softness and breathability. A material that feels substantial without being stiff is produced by this combination.
Important details regarding the fabric blend:
- Cotton: Provides comfort and softness.
- Polyester: Enhances durability, strength, and shape retention.
- Balance: Make sure the sweatshirt is both wearable and heavy.
Density and structure are given priority in the Gap Yeezy Sweatshirt, in contrast to many fast-fashion hoodies that skimp on material with thin or loosely knit stitches.
